Memorial Day weekend 2023 will be here before you know it. First and foremost, the holiday is about honoring soldiers who died while fighting for our country. While you may take time to reflect on the patriotism and sacrifice that represents the holiday through Memorial Day activities, many people also consider Memorial Day weekend to be the first real weekend of summer. And for lots of families, that means firing up the grill, having friends over, sipping summer co*cktails, and enjoying the warm weather.
You’ve probably thought about what Memorial Day recipes will be part of this year’s festivities. Burgers are definitely a must, and it’s not a summer cookout without corn on the cob. But why not get a little more creative this year? Try adding some flavorful shrimp to the menu, or get out the food processor to make a creamy dip everyone will love. It’s never a bad idea to have a bright, flavorful salad for vegetarian guests (although omnivores will also appreciate it, we’re sure). And of course, you can’t forget dessert. Homemade popsicles are easy to prep and sure to be a hit. If your Memorial Day barbecue attendees are 21+, then they’ll enjoy a sweet summer co*cktail with their meal. Many of them are even easy to customize to make alcohol-free, for non-drinkers or those under 21.
Read on for the best, easiest Memorial Day recipes to make the first weekend of summer a great one.

Smoky Chicken with Charred-Corn Salad
No grill? No problem. Both the chipotle chicken and the charred corn for this easy meal can be cooked in a cast-iron skillet.

Beet and Feta Dip
This creamy dip is not only gorgeous (look at that color!) but also tasty. Chickpeas, feta cheese, beets, garlic and lemon all come together quickly in a food processor. Your guests will absolutely love it paired with pita bread and veggies.
